Crawl Space Solutions
In the greater Virginia Beach area, many of the homes were built with crawl spaces in addition to basements. For many years, these were constructed with vents which was intended to increase fresh air flow through the space and keep it dry. Unfortunately, the opposite is usually what happens. Having open vents allows water to get in when it rains or snows and the vents prevent proper evaporation which causes the humidity levels to stay high which will eventually harbor the growth of mildew. We have found that up to 50% of the air in your home can come up through the crawl space so ensuring the crawl space is protected from the outside and keeping the humidity levels low will improve the overall air quality in your home.
Our team has been working on crawl spaces since we opened our doors and we know the best way to seal them off and control the humidity. This is done using a process called encapsulation which is the installation of a thick liner or vapor barrier, occasionally installed with insulation products, and are heavy duty plastic and vinyl sheets as well as covers to close off existing vents and a heavy duty door that will close off the area totally and prevent any unwanted moisture from entering. Encapsulation will also prevent critters and animals from settling in the crawl space which will keep any equipment there safe and allow you to use it for storage. After the crawl space is encapsulated, if necessary we will install a system of sagging floor jacks to lift sinking floors above the crawl space.
Structural Foundation Repair
Your foundation is quite possibly one of, if not the, most important areas of the home. It not only supports the structure itself but it also creates the basement walls. When you've got foundation problems, they will generally show themselves in the form of stair-step cracks in the outside brickwork, long cracks that run the length of the foundation or along basement walls. You may also notice that the windows and doors will get stuck or there may be cracks at the corners of them. While these issues may not seem critical when you notice them, they are all indicative of a sinking or settling foundation and they should be evaluated by an expert for specific problems to determine what type of a repair needs to be in place.
Thankfully, many foundation problems stem from similar issues and our team is very good at spotting those problems. We can utilize a repair product intended for your exact issue to permanently repair and stabilize the foundation or walls. If the problem is a uneven foundation, we will implement a system of foundation piers to level the foundation. Depending on how bad it is and where it is, we will use either helical piers or push piers. Both types are very strong and can help stabilize your foundation.
